Global restaurant brands run their operation on the Crunchtime platform. Delivering a consistent guest experience across every location and managing food and labor costs are at the core of how Crunchtime's software is used today in over 150,000 locations across 100+ countries by the world's top restaurant and foodservice operators. Customers including Chipotle, Culver's, Domino's, Dunkin', Five Guys and P.F. Chang's rely on our top-ranked platform which now includes Zenput to manage inventory, staff scheduling, learning and development, food safety, operational tasks and audits.

About CrunchTime

CrunchTime is a software company that provides restaurant management solutions. The company's platform includes tools for inventory management, labor scheduling, and food cost analysis, and is used by restaurants of all sizes, from small independent establishments to large chains. CrunchTime's software can be integrated with a variety of point-of-sale systems and other restaurant technologies. The company was founded in 1995 and is headquartered in Boston, Massachusetts.
